He hasn't spent as much time on it this year because he thinks the pick will be traded. He is looking more at guys later in the Draft that he thinks are undervalued. One of those was Procida who until a month or so ago, wasn't even in the 2nd round of some Mocks. Now he is up to early 2nd round and possibly even late 1st round.

Other 'sleepers' he likes are Moore, Minott, Kamagate.....depending on where they are selected. Thinks guys like Nzosa and Badji are athletic freaks that need better coaching and are worth a shot at in the late 2nd round. Nzosa was a projected high Lottery pick coming into this season.
